Koneru Humpy and Divya Deshmukh are set to face each other in the all-India final at the Chess World Cup final, starting Saturday, July 26. While Humpy beat Tingjie Lei in the semis, Deshmukh got the better of Zhongyi Tan.

The FIDE Women's World Cup in Batumi, Georgia will see a battle of generations as 38-year-old Koneru Humpy takes on 19-year-old Divya Deshmukh in the two-game final starting from Saturday
Koneru Humpy hails Divya Deshmukh’s tremendous run ahead of FIDE Women’s World Cup 2025 final
Divya, currently an International Master, stormed into the semifinal by trouncing higher-ranked opponents in the previous rounds - Chinese GM Zhu Jiner in the pre-quarterfinal and Indian GM D Harika in the quarterfinal.
